If you haven’t already discovered Vitamasques’ and their Hydrate Blue Agave Biodegradable Face Sheet Mask, go buy it now. This is a hydrating mask that boosts moisture retention and hydrating effects with 6 types of hyaluronic acid, combined with vegan squalane, agave, seaberry and spirulina - essentially we can totally see this as a summer or dead of winter must-have (you know, when your skin is either sunburnt or dry af). What we went gaga for was that this packet was filled with tons of serum that was also quite gelatinous meaning the mask fully laid on our our face and that there was plenty of adaptogenic serum (i.e. herbal pharmaceuticals that work to counteract the effects of stress in the body) to apply and stick around. Most masks we’ve tried have had air bubbles, slipped off our face, or left us squeezing the packs for any last dredges of serum but not this guy.



Bonus - the pouch is fully sustainable and biodegradable utilizing paper, plant-based film and environmentally friendly printing technology, with the following benefits:


  • Product carbon emissions reduced by 48%

  • Natural plant cellulose sheet mask

  • Biodegradable

  • RoHS compliant eco print

  • Vegan-friendly masks
